Abstract

Disclosed is a software development system that enables a developer to create a service module by visually arranging at least one terminal module each executing a unit task. The system includes a module flow designer that generates a module flow configuration diagram of a service module having at least one terminal module; a source generation unit that generates a source code of the service module in accordance with the module flow configuration diagram; a meta management unit that analyzes the metadata of the service module; and a metadata storage unit that stores the metadata of the service module. The meta management unit generates the metadata of the service module by using metadata of the module flow configuration diagram.
